Wrenfold consumes bounce notifications from our outbound mail pipeline, classifies them as hard or soft, and updates recipient status in the Saltmarsh directory. Hard bounces suppress the address immediately; soft bounces are retried up to four times over 48 hours before suppression. As a contractor, you'll mostly interact with the classification rules file — don't edit it without review, since misclassification can suppress valid recipients. For access requests or rule-change reviews, contact the deliverability team at the address below.

alerts address for kajog-tadup: druox@plorvanet.internal

### Releasing the Pulsegrid Sidecar

Quick one for support: the metrics-aggregation sidecar ships independently from the main Pulsegrid agent, so customers can be on mismatched versions — that's fine down to two minors back. When pushing a hotfix build to the staging registry, the upload must be signed or it'll bounce with a 403. Sign the bundle with the key below.

signing key of bagap-yawep = bky13_TbfT6ZMUoGJo2

Runbook: account recovery via Latchfield gateway. So the rate limiter on Latchfield sometimes eats recovery OTP requests when a tenant is bursting — you'll see 429s in the recovery funnel dashboard. Quick fix: bump the tenant's bucket via the override endpoint, wait one refill cycle, then re-trigger the OTP. Don't disable the limiter globally, ever. To use the override endpoint, authenticate with the passphrase below.

unlock words, fadug-tageg: zorix-wenwyn-quenmir

# Clock skew handling for Forgeline build agents.
# Support: when customers report "build finished before it started,"
# it's skew between agents, not corruption. The scheduler tolerates
# drift up to a threshold, warns in a middle band, and quarantines
# agents beyond it. Do not raise limits to silence tickets; fix NTP
# on the agent instead. Thresholds are defined below.

limits module of haweg-badug:
RATE_LIMITS = {
    "casox": 339,
    "wenix": 653,
    "rusok": 650,
    "lamix": 337,
    "aldvan": 753,
}